TP钱包“没网”原因全解析:从节点故障到Layer2与智能支付时代的应对

问题表现与常见误判:当用户说“TP钱包没网了”,实际可能指App无法显示余额、无法广播交易、DApp连接失败或钱包内置浏览器页面空白。很多人第一时间以为是本地网络故障,但链上或中间件问题更常见。

技术层面原因分析:

1) 本地网络或设备:Wi-Fi/DNS、系统省电策略、手机时间不同步可造成TLS握手失败;VPN或运营商屏蔽会影响特定RPC域名。排查建议:切换移动数据、重启App、校准时间。

2) RPC/节点不可用:TP钱包依赖公共或自建RPC节点,节点宕机、数据库回滚或CORS策略变更都会导致“无网”。临时解决可切换备用RPC或使用去中心化RPC服务。

3) 链端事件与拥堵:网络拥堵、链分叉或重大升级(hard fork)会影响节点同步,造成客户端显示不同步或交易提交失败。

4) Layer2/二层网络问题:在Arbitrum、Optimism、zk-rollup等Layer2上,sequencer停机、状态回放或桥服务异常会让Layer2资产与主网看似“离线”。需检查对应Layer2官方状态与中继服务。

5) 应用/合约限制与权限:DApp请求被拒绝、合约调用失败或Token合约被暂停也会呈现为“没网”。

6) 版本与兼容性:旧版客户端或浏览器内核与新RPC或EIP不兼容,同样会导致连接失败。

从智能支付方案角度:

现代钱包在支付层要支持meta-transactions(免gas/代付)、支付通道、批量交易与法币入金。若智能支付后端(paymaster、relayer)不可用,用户体验就是“网络不可用”。设计上应加入冗余relayer、多签回退和离线队列。

全球化数字变革与合规影响:

跨境监管、域名封锁、跨国合规审查会影响节点可达性。为全球用户提供稳定体验需本地化节点部署、合规的KYC/AML方案与多区域CDN保障RPC与DApp静态资源分发。

行业洞察(运维与产品建议):

- 指标必需:RPC可用率、平均响应时延、交易失败率、节点延迟分布和用户地域映射。

- 经验最佳实践:节点自动切换、熔断与降级策略、用户可见性提示(告知是否为本地网络/链端/Layer2问题)。

先进科技前沿与可行解:

采用去中心化RPC(p2p路由、lightning-like路由)、多链/多节点负载均衡、zk-proof轻客户端验证可以提升可用性与隐私。对Layer2,采用跨链轻客户端和异步确认能缓解sequencer短暂不可用的影响。

支付设置与用户自助修复清单:

- 检查网络(Wi-Fi/4G/VPN)并重启App;

- 在钱包设置切换RPC节点或恢复默认节点;

- 更新App到最新版本并清理缓存;

- 尝试在另一个钱包/浏览器广播交易以排除链端问题;

- 查看TP钱包官方及Layer2节点状态页与社交媒体公告;

- 若频繁出现,导出私钥/助记词并在安全环境下导入其他客户端进行进一步排查。

结论与产品建议:

“没网”并非单一问题,而是设备网络、RPC/节点、链自身、Layer2中继与支付中间件多层问题的集合体。对于产品方,应从冗余节点、智能路由、清晰的用户提示以及对智能支付后端(relayer、paymaster)的高可用设计入手;对于用户,优先做本地网络与RPC切换检查,并关注官方状态公告与更新。

作者:李行者发布时间:2025-12-03 15:38:46

评论

Crypto小白

写得很清楚,我刚按文中切换了RPC,问题解决了,谢谢!

Alex_W

对Layer2 sequencer不可用这点没想到,学到了。希望钱包能自动切换备用通道。

链上观察者

建议开发团队把状态页做得更显眼,很多用户根本不知道哪里看节点状态。

张工程师

补充:手机时间不对会导致TLS失败,遇到过一次定位了半天,很实用的排查步骤。

相关阅读